Why Facebook Two-Factor Authentication isn&#8217;t Working<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p><b>Common Issues<\/b><br \/>\nFacebook two-factor authentication is a security feature that requires users to input an additional code after logging in. This added layer of <a href=\"https:\/\/logmeonce.com\/passwordless-qr-code-login\/\">security helps protect users<\/a> against malicious actors, but unfortunately, it isn&#8217;t always working properly. Here are some common issues reported by users: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Receiving an incorrect verification code<\/li>\n<li>Not receiving a code at all<\/li>\n<li>Inability to reset a forgotten password<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><b>Distributed Denial of Service (DDoS) Attacks<\/b><br \/>\nThe authentication servers can also be <a href=\"https:\/\/logmeonce.com\/resources\/facebook-2-factor-authentication-not-working\/\" title=\"Facebook 2 Factor Authentication Not Working\">rendered temporarily unavailable due<\/a> to a Distributed Denial of Service (DDoS). A DDoS attack is a malicious attempt to disrupt normal traffic, block access to a system and drastically slow it down. This causes Facebook two-factor authentication codes to be delayed or not be received at all. While Facebook is taking steps to protect their servers, it is a constant cat-and-mouse game between malicious actors and Facebook security teams.<\/p>\n<h2 id=\"2-understanding-what-two-factor-authentication-is\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"2_Understanding_What_Two-Factor_Authentication_Is\"><\/span>2. Understanding What Two-Factor Authentication Is<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>Two-factor authentication is a way of adding an extra layer of security to your online accounts. Unlike traditional passwords, two-factor authentication requires you to prove your identity by providing two pieces of evidence instead of just one. With two-factor authentication, your account will remain protected even if someone guesses your password or steals your login credentials.<\/p>\n<p>The two pieces of evidence you provide when using two-factor authentication are usually something you know \u2013 like a PIN or password \u2013 and something you have \u2013 like a physical token or your smartphone. This means that for someone to gain access to your account, they would need to have both the PIN\/password and the physical token or your smartphone. This makes it much harder for anyone to guess or steal your information.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Knowledge factors<\/strong> \u2013 something only the user knows, such as a PIN, password or security answer.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Possession factors<\/strong> \u2013 something only the user has, such as a physical token or a smartphone.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Biometric factors<\/strong> \u2013 something the user is, such as a fingerprint or Retina scan.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2 id=\"3-tips-for-troubleshooting-facebook-2fa-issues\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"3_Tips_for_Troubleshooting_Facebook_2FA_Issues\"><\/span>3. Tips for Troubleshooting Facebook 2FA Issues<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p><b>Tip 1: Check your Facebook Settings<\/b><\/p>\n<p>Before you start troubleshooting 2FA issues, you should first check that 2FA is enabled in your Facebook settings. This can usually be found in the \u2018Security and Login\u2019 portion of the settings page. Making sure that 2FA is switched on for your account can prevent future 2FA issues.<\/p>\n<p><b>Tip 2: Restart your device<\/b><\/p>\n<p>Sometimes the easiest way to solve any technological problem is to just restart your device. This can rectify a lot of issues, so if you\u2019re having troubles with 2FA, restarting your phone or computer can help. If this doesn\u2019t solve the problem, the following steps should be taken: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Check that you\u2019ve entered your authentication code correctly.<\/li>\n<li>Ensure that the system time and date on your device is correct.<\/li>\n<li>Try logging in after enabling your Wi-Fi or data.<\/li>\n<li>Disable and then re-enable 2FA.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2 id=\"4-how-to-stay-secure-without-2fa-on-facebook\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"4_How_to_Stay_Secure_Without_2FA_on_Facebook\"><\/span>4. How to Stay Secure Without 2FA on Facebook<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p><b>1. Use Strong Passwords<\/b> <\/p>\n<p>The best defense against unauthorized access to your Facebook account is to use strong passwords. A strong password should be a minimum of 8 characters long, and should include a combination of uppercase and lowercase letters, symbols, and numbers. Never use the same password for any other accounts. It\u2019s also a good idea to change your password periodically.<\/p>\n<p><b>2. Set Up Login Alerts<\/b><\/p>\n<p>Enable alerts to your email address and\/or phone when someone attempts to access your account. Facebook will send you a notification as soon as it detects a login attempt, giving you time to take action if someone other than you is attempting to log in. If you receive an alert, take immediate steps to secure your account. <\/p>\n<h2 id=\"qa\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Q_A\"><\/span>Q&#038;A<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>Q: What is two-factor authentication on Facebook?<br \/>\nA: Two-factor authentication on Facebook is an extra layer of security to help keep your account safe.
